Department of Vision and Hearing Sciences hosts visitors from the Islamic University Gaza

Our Department of Vision Hearing Sciences recently had the pleasure of hosting visiting staff from the Islamic University of Gaza. Head of Department Dr John Siderov welcomed Dr Nazmi Al-Masri and Dr Mohammed Hussein from the University and conducted a tour of the Department and the University Eye Clinic facilities.

Discussions were held on possible student exchanges and research collaborations between the two institutions and also on ways in which our Department can contribute to improvements in Optometry provision and training in the region.

The Islamic University of Gaza was established in 1978 to provide higher education to students in the Gaza Strip, who had previously had to seek higher education in Egypt. The University has since grown rapidly to encompass ten faculties offering a range of BA, BSc, MA and MSc courses, and gaining both national and international recognition.

Speaking of the visit Dr John Siderov commented "The visit from colleagues from the IUG was very welcome. We agreed to continue to work together to find ways in which our two institutions could collaborate to develop optometry in Gaza."
